These are a beautiful set of Georgian silver teaspoons decorated to the front stems with bright-cut engraving incorporating original "C" ownership initials. 

The set of six spoons was made towards the close of the 18th century by the partnership of Peter and Ann Bateman; the former being the son of the famous Hester, and the latter her daughter-in-law (widow of Jonathan). The spoons are in excellent condition with crisp decoration and good, unworn bowls.
